In the play "Trfile" the dead bird found by Mrs. Hale and Mrs. Peters, the wives of the County Attorney and a neighboring farmer represents Mrs. Wright's youth and happiness.

Mr. Wright had been abusing his wife for years, taking away her joyful spirit. Him killing her pet bird was a tipping point for Mrs. Wright, as she then decided to hung her own husband.
